Transaction 78c107553f64c9f26405c7e5019687f570f3a7bd1a2547ae264337e9dd5657f5
1 Input
1 Output
-
78c107553f64c9f26405c7e5019687f570f3a7bd1a2547ae264337e9dd5657f5:0
- value
- 543564
- script pubkey
- OP_0 OP_PUSHBYTES_20 8243db435d92a38399a63ba4209eec44c136455e
- address
- bc1qsfpaks6aj23c8xdx8wjzp8hvgnqnv327l9zlnh